The artificial intelligence system is 90% accurate in selecting the best quality embryos

The research team trained the artificial intelligence system using images of embryos captured 113 hours after artificial insemination. Out of 742 embryos, the AI ​​system was 90% accurate in selecting the best quality embryos. The researchers further evaluated the AI ​​system\’s ability to differentiate between high-quality embryos with normal numbers of human chromosomes and compared the system\’s performance with that of trained embryologists. The system is about 75 percent accurate, compared with an average of 67 percent for embryologists.
